NEWBURGH, Ind. - Heritage Federal Credit Union has launched a Youth Affinity Program to benefit the Evansville Vanderburgh School Corporation Extracurricular Fund. From June 1 through August 1, Heritage FCU will donate $5 per new checking account and up to $100 per every new loan to the EVSC ECA Fund. The fund has been established to cover the cost of scholastic, music, sports and other extracurricular activities. "We know we have many members and employees with children who are affected by the possible loss of extracurricular programs," said Heritage FCU President Ron McConnell. "During this two month campaign, we would like to contribute up to $25,000 to help ensure that band concerts, plays, academic bowls and all such activities will not cease for Vanderburgh County's young people and families."
